What are the typical responsibilities of an LM2500 technician on a daily basis?

As an LM2500 technician, your daily responsibilities typically include performing routine inspections, troubleshooting, and maintenance on the LM2500 gas turbine engine. You will monitor system performance, address any mechanical or electrical issues, and ensure all work adheres to safety and quality standards. Collaboration is common with engineers and other technical staff to plan maintenance schedules and resolve complex technical problems. This role often requires careful documentation and adherence to strict protocols, especially in industries such as marine, power generation, or aviation.

What is an LM2500?

The LM2500 is a type of aeroderivative gas turbine engine designed and manufactured by General Electric. It is widely used for marine propulsion, industrial power generation, and mechanical drive applications due to its reliability, efficiency, and compact design. The LM2500 is based on aircraft engine technology and is commonly found in naval ships, offshore platforms, and power plants around the world. Its modular construction allows for ease of maintenance and high operational availability.

Position Summary
Responsible for the timely execution of gas turbine repair work at the field level. Provide input and assist in the creation and improvement of field service procedures involving field service repairs and inspection processes. Ensure quality Field Service inspections and repairs via precision and attention to detail.
Reports To: Field Services Manager
Work Location: 8310 McHard Road, Houston, TX 77053
Position Responsibilities
  • Compliance with all company policies, procedures, and commercial commitments.
  • Communicate effectively with the field service staff and management.
  • Perform engine/field inspection work with precision and attention to detail.
  • Perform disassembly and reassembly process of gas turbines.
  • Assist the field services team with input and in the creation, improvement and implementation of procedures of field service work procedures and inspection processes.
  • Conduct engine removal and installation.
  • Assist Senior Aero Field Technician in the preparation of field service reports, which include documenting project activities and project updates.
  • Communicate effectively with the Aero Field Service staff and management.
  • Ensure a clean and safe work environment.
  • Extensive travel (75% - 90%) is required.
Required qualifications
  • A two-year technical degree in aviation or mechanics and 3 or more years work experience performing service work for Aero-derivative Gas Turbines; OR High School diploma, or equivalent and 5 or more years of relevant work experience in lieu of advanced education.
  • U.S. work authorization is a precondition of employment. The company will not consider candidates who require sponsorship for a work-authorized Visa.
  • Successful candidate will need to satisfactorily complete the following:
    • Pre-employment drug screen, background check, including a Motor Vehicle Record review.
    • DISA background and drug screen requirements as indicated by a PROENERGY client.
Desired Qualifications
  • A amp;P (Airframe amp; Powerplant) license
  • The ability to travel domestically amp; internationally.
  • Has a demonstrated understanding of aero gas turbine maintenance functions.
  • Knowledge and understanding of performing a borescope inspection of a LM2500/LM6000
  • Knowledge and understanding on the performance of a Hot Section Exchange for a LM2500/LM6000
  • Knowledge and understanding on how to remove and install an LM2500 GG/GT, LM2500 PT, and an LM6000
  • Knowledge and understanding of how to perform the laser alignment of a LM2500/LM6000
  • Knowledge and understanding how to perform engine external and package inspections of the LM2500/LM6000
  • Knowledge and understanding on how to perform various inspections or maintenance activities in the field.
  • Knowledge and ability to perform critical measurements with a variety of specialized tools like a micrometer, Vernier caliper, etc.
  • Ability to work in a team environment.
  • Technical competence (understand software, hardware, networks, etc).
  • Demonstrate the ability to provide crane operators the proper signals when performing a lift.
  • Demonstrate the ability to properly rig a load prior to performing a lift
